| 'use strict'; |
| |
| // This tests module.enableCompileCache() with an options object still works with environment |
| // variable NODE_COMPILE_CACHE overrides. |
| |
| require('../common'); |
| const { spawnSyncAndAssert } = require('../common/child_process'); |
| const assert = require('assert'); |
| const fixtures = require('../common/fixtures'); |
| const tmpdir = require('../common/tmpdir'); |
| const fs = require('fs'); |
| const path = require('path'); |
| |
| const wrapper = fixtures.path('compile-cache-wrapper-options.js'); |
| tmpdir.refresh(); |
| |
| // Create a build directory and copy the entry point file. |
| const buildDir = tmpdir.resolve('build'); |
| fs.mkdirSync(buildDir); |
| const entryPoint = path.join(buildDir, 'empty.js'); |
| fs.copyFileSync(fixtures.path('empty.js'), entryPoint); |
| |
| // Check that the portable option can be overridden by NODE_COMPILE_CACHE_PORTABLE. |
| // We don't override NODE_COMPILE_CACHE because it will enable the cache before |
| // the wrapper is loaded. |
| spawnSyncAndAssert( |
| process.execPath, |
| ['-r', wrapper, entryPoint], |
| { |
| env: { |
| ...process.env, |
| NODE_DEBUG_NATIVE: 'COMPILE_CACHE', |
| NODE_COMPILE_CACHE_PORTABLE: '1', |
| NODE_TEST_COMPILE_CACHE_OPTIONS: JSON.stringify({ directory: 'build/.compile_cache' }), |
| }, |
| cwd: tmpdir.path |
| }, |
| { |
| stdout(output) { |
| console.log(output); // Logging for debugging. |
| assert.match(output, /dir before enableCompileCache: undefined/); |
| assert.match(output, /Compile cache enabled/); |
| assert.match(output, /dir after enableCompileCache: .*build[/\\]\.compile_cache/); |
| return true; |
| }, |
| stderr(output) { |
| console.log(output); // Logging for debugging. |
| assert.match(output, /reading cache from .*build[/\\]\.compile_cache.* for CommonJS .*empty\.js/); |
| assert.match(output, /empty\.js was not initialized, initializing the in-memory entry/); |
| assert.match(output, /writing cache for .*empty\.js.*success/); |
| return true; |
| } |
| }); |
| |
| assert(fs.existsSync(tmpdir.resolve('build/.compile_cache'))); |
| |
| const movedDir = buildDir + '_moved'; |
| fs.renameSync(buildDir, movedDir); |
| const movedEntryPoint = path.join(movedDir, 'empty.js'); |
| |
| // When portable is undefined, it should use the env var NODE_COMPILE_CACHE_PORTABLE. |
| spawnSyncAndAssert( |
| process.execPath, |
| ['-r', wrapper, movedEntryPoint], |
| { |
| env: { |
| ...process.env, |
| NODE_DEBUG_NATIVE: 'COMPILE_CACHE', |
| NODE_COMPILE_CACHE_PORTABLE: '1', |
| NODE_TEST_COMPILE_CACHE_OPTIONS: JSON.stringify({ directory: 'build_moved/.compile_cache' }), |
| }, |
| cwd: tmpdir.path |
| }, |
| { |
| stdout(output) { |
| console.log(output); // Logging for debugging. |
| assert.match(output, /dir before enableCompileCache: undefined/); |
| assert.match(output, /Compile cache enabled/); |
| assert.match(output, /dir after enableCompileCache: .*build_moved[/\\]\.compile_cache/); |
| return true; |
| }, |
| stderr(output) { |
| console.log(output); // Logging for debugging. |
| assert.match(output, /reading cache from .*build_moved[/\\]\.compile_cache.* for CommonJS .*empty\.js/); |
| assert.match(output, /cache for .*empty\.js was accepted, keeping the in-memory entry/); |
| assert.match(output, /.*skip .*empty\.js because cache was the same/); |
| return true; |
| } |
| }); |
